Understanding Bentonite Clay


Bentonite is a natural clay formed from volcanic ash that has undergone a chemical alteration over time. It is primarily composed of montmorillonite, a type of clay mineral that swells when wet, making it an ideal candidate for cat litter. The unique properties of bentonite allow it to absorb moisture effectively, clump together when wet, and neutralize odors, creating a cleaner environment for both cats and their owners.

Economic Opportunities and Factory Growth


The rising demand for bentonite cat litter has opened up numerous economic opportunities. Entrepreneurs and established companies alike have recognized the potential for profit in this niche market, leading to a proliferation of bentonite cat litter factories. These factories leverage the abundant natural resources available in certain regions, particularly where bentonite clay is abundantly extracted.


Establishing a bentonite cat litter factory involves several steps, including sourcing high-quality clay, processing it into usable litter, and ensuring compliance with environmental regulations. The process often entails mining the bentonite, drying, and milling it into fine granules. Some factories also add fragrances or other additives to enhance the litter's appeal and functionality.

Sustainability and Environmental Concerns


As the number of bentonite cat litter factories grows, so do concerns surrounding sustainability and environmental impact. Mining bentonite can disrupt local ecosystems, and excessive production poses risks associated with waste and resource depletion. Consequently, it is imperative for manufacturers to adopt sustainable practices, such as responsible mining techniques and water conservation measures, to mitigate environmental harm.


Moreover, consumers are becoming increasingly conscious of the environmental footprint of their choices. Many factories are now exploring ways to produce biodegradable options or incorporating recycled materials into their litter products. By addressing these environmental concerns, bentonite cat litter producers can enhance their appeal and secure a loyal customer base.
